I've decided to take the plunge. After 7 months of being a good little Eve citizen I've packed up my gear, sold off my empire assets and moved to low sec. It's time to become a pirate.

I started playing this game back in May after becoming bored of EQ2. I had read the "Great Scam" story and was intrigued by the openness of Eve, so I downloaded the demo and started a new character. Within 2 hours I was hooked and I've stayed hooked ever since.

I've tried most of the carebear professions Eve has to offer and none of them could really capture my interest. I came to realize that the only long-term hook for me in this game would be in PvP, piracy specifically. Piracy has always called to me as a way to live outside the law and prey on the fringes of empire but until now, I haven't committed myself to the dark side.

Now, I've got some ISK, I've got some SPs and I've got a ship with some guns ready to fire. I expect that over the next few months I'll learn some harsh lessons but I hope to teach a few as well. I'll be sharing my experiences of starting a new profession as a low-sec pirate and I welcome any hints from those who have gone before me.

I disagree, be afraid of losing your ship! As a pirate, ISK will be pretty sparse so keep your wits about you and don't do anything stupid. Learn the basics in a T1 frig because especially at first, you'll be replacing your gear very often.
